Expression of Septin4 in Schistosoma japonicum-infected mouse livers after praziquantel treatment
Abstract Background Septin4 (SEPT4) exists widely in human tissues and is related to mechanical stability, actin dynamics, membrane trafficking, viral replication and apoptosis.
